Vermont man accused of reckless driving, crashing into police cruiser in Rockland

Photo: Knox County Correctional Facility


Police say a Vermont man struck a police cruiser in Rockland while driving drunk.

29-year-old Tilford Tillman faces several charges after police received a call Wednesday afternoon about a vehicle driving recklessly and following a woman around town.

Police say Tillman continued following the woman when she pulled into the police station, then struck a parked police cruiser and drove off.

Police later found Tillman and his vehicle and took him into custody.
